"My Life on Fire" - Molly Byrd - Motorcycles and Hurricanes- What One Person can Do

For thirty-five years to the day, Molly Byrd worked first as a secretary, before becoming a long-time legal assistant and mentor to many in the Winston-Salem office of the law firm of Womble Carlyle, now known as the international firm of Womble Bond & Dickinson.

That is just a part of her story. For the last eighteen years, she has taught hundreds of people to ride motorcycles all over the country. She herself has ridden to Key West and New York City, mainly to see the Statue of Liberty.

For the last month, she has traveled west to the mountains of North Carolina where she took clothes and her chainsaw to help stranded and now homeless people who are trying to survive the hopefully once in a life-time hurricane that devastated the western part of the state.

Meanwhile, she loves nothing better than to work and rest on her 35-acre farm, a place where she grew up and later inherited from her Dad.

Molly is a person for all seasons. Her philosophy for a long and happy life is simple. She wants to help people, wherever they may be.
